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 42% of 30.1 using proportion.

42% is 42 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 42 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 30.1.

\[ \frac{ 42 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 30.1 } \]

Cross-multiply: 42 × 30.1 = 100x

\[ 42 \cdot 30.1 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(42 × 30.1)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 1264.2 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 42% of 30.1 is 12.642.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 42% to decimal: 0.42

\[ x = 30.1 \cdot 0.42 \]

Multiply 30.1 × 0.42 = 12.642

So, 42% of 30.1 is 12.642.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 42% to decimal: 0.42

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

30.1 × 0.42 = 12.642

Thus, 42% of 30.1 is 12.642.
